Cell towers in Norfolk, Nebraska
The FCC register lists 20 antenna structures in and around Norfolk. That is the 9th highest count of any place in Nebraska.
Overview
Norfolk, NE has 20 registered structures, the tallest standing 124 m (407 ft) above ground.
Area density is 1.10 per square mile — usually the more telling figure for infrastructure that follows terrain, roads and line of sight rather than population.
At a median of 70 m (231 ft), structures here run 3.6% shorter than the Nebraska median of 73 m (240 ft).
The mix here is 3 monopoles, 3 lattice towers, 3 guyed masts — the rest of the register is made up of rooftops, water tanks and structures the FCC records without a specific type.
The most recent registration on file here dates from 2020.

About this data
All figures on this page are aggregated from the federal antenna structure register of 2026-08-23, not from carrier coverage data. The two answer different questions.
The FCC Antenna Structure Registration database covers structures that require registration — generally those over 200 feet or near airports. Many small cells, rooftop antennas and short towers are not registered and will not appear here.
"Owner" is the entity that registered the structure, usually a tower company such as American Tower or Crown Castle. It does not indicate which carriers operate equipment on the structure.
